Abstract: |
An evaluation was undertaken to determine the archaeological implications of proposed development of the former Angel Inn and Loughborough Motors sites. The investigation revealed remains of post-medieval development on reclaimed alluvial deposits. Evidence suggested the possibility of revetment or a river bank closer to the river. Upon the surface of these a cottage had been built on the Loughborough Motors site, whilst behind the former Angel Inn, numerous pits indicated refuse disposal. Finds included a sequence of pottery dating from the medieval period to the present day and a single sherd of Saxon pottery. [Au(abr)] |
